Just YouTube videos from what we saw.
YouTube videos are played in iframes. It looks like the in-app browser doesn't
clean up fully on closing and somehow (I suspect) the iframe and its content is
left lingering. In any event, you can hear the YouTube video still playing
after the in-app browser has been closed.
The attached code changes the exit procedure to make sure everything is
cleaned-up when the in-app browser is exited (either by the Done button or the
Android back button).

> InAppBrowser - video/audio does not stop playing when browser is closed

> This is a recurrence of an issue that was previously fixed: CB-1957
> Steps to reproduce
> 1. Load a YouTube video (with audio track) in the InAppBrowser
> 2. Play the video
> 3. Close InAppBrowser
> Expected result:
> - Audio stops playing
> Actual result:
> - Audio continues playing
> Fix:
> We encountered this bug as part of development and modified the InAppBrowser
> plugin to resolve it. The fix is part of our production code, is stable and
> has been through our QA. It does require extending the Android Dialog class,
> however.
> I've added an attachment with the modified Java files.
